In Arkansas, the Title IX law is a powerful tool for survivors of sexual assault on college campuses. This federal legislation mandates that educational institutions ensure equal access to education and prohibit discrimination based on gender, including sexual harassment and assault. Understanding your rights under Title IX is crucial for survivors seeking justice and support. A dedicated title ix law firm Arkansas can offer comprehensive guidance, ensuring you receive the legal advice needed to navigate this complex process effectively.
Arkansas’s implementation of Title IX requires colleges and universities to have policies in place that address sexual misconduct, provide clear reporting procedures, and ensure due process for all parties involved. Survivors should be aware of their rights to privacy, confidentiality, and support services throughout the investigation and resolution processes. Navigating the legal process after a college assault can be daunting, but understanding your rights is essential. If you are a victim of sexual misconduct or assault at an Arkansas college, it’s crucial to know that you have options and resources available to help. Many institutions in Arkansas have policies in place to address these issues, including procedures for reporting and investigating incidents, and they are required by the Title IX law to provide equal access to education without discrimination based on gender.
A Title IX legal advice can guide victims through the process of filing a complaint, ensuring their rights are protected. This includes understanding the timeframes for reporting, the institutional response, and potential legal avenues for justice and accountability.
